BARTON MINES CORPORATION v. C. I. R.

Nos. 675-678, Dockets 35382, 35383, 35387 and 35388.

446 F.2d 981 (1971)

BARTON MINES CORPORATION, Appellant and Cross-Appellee, v. COMMISSIONER OF INTERNAL REVENUE, Appellee and Cross-Appellant.

United States Court of Appeals, Second Circuit.

Decided July 19, 1971.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Robert S. Ryan, Philadelphia, Pa. (John M. Miller, Jr., Jere R. Thomson, and Drinker, Biddle & Reath, Philadelphia, Pa., and John S. Allee, New York City, on the brief), for Barton Mines Corp.

William S. Estabrook, Tax Div., Dept. of Justice, Washington, D. C. (Johnnie M. Walters, Asst. Atty. Gen., Meyer Rothwacks, and Grant W. Wiprud, Tax Div., Dept. of Justice, Washington, D. C., on the brief), for Commissioner of Internal Revenue.

Before FRIENDLY, Chief Judge, SMITH and ANDERSON, Circuit Judges.


ANDERSON, Circuit Judge:

These appeals involve the calculation of the percentage depletion permitted to Barton Mines Corporation (Barton) which mines ore containing eight to ten per cent garnet by volume and reduces it to garnet grains and powders of 98% purity by means of various processes, designed both to convert the garnet to desired sizes and to attain a purity level dictated by competition in the abrasives industry.
